Fishing in Worcestershire

Worcestershire offers 41 mapped fishing waters on PiscaMaps, including 39 rivers, 1 stillwater and 1 canal. Species found across Worcestershire's waters include Eel, Roach, Chub, Dace, Gudgeon, Trout, Perch, Pike.

The Midlands EA region encompasses the rivers of the English heartland. The Severn, Trent, Avon and Wye are among the country's finest coarse fisheries, renowned for barbel, chub, bream, roach and perch. The Derbyshire Wye and upper Dove are outstanding fly fishing rivers for wild brown trout and grayling.

A valid Environment Agency (EA) rod licence is required to fish all rivers, canals and most stillwaters in Worcestershire. Licences are available from gov.uk. Club membership or a day ticket is required on most waters in addition to the rod licence.

Carp are a popular target across Worcestershire's waters — always use a landing net and unhooking mat and return fish promptly.

Barbel fishing is well regarded in Worcestershire's rivers, particularly through summer and autumn when water temperatures are higher.

Brown trout are present in Worcestershire's rivers — many are catch-and-release only and may be subject to game fishing close seasons (typically 1 October to 14 March).

Salmon are present in some of Worcestershire's rivers. A migratory salmonid licence is required in addition to the standard rod licence.
